UNDESIRABLE PERSON

AN AMERICAN ENGINEER EXCLUDED FROM NAVY WORK WASHINGTON. (Rec. 11.30 p.m.) Feb. 23. The Navy Department has announced the exclusion of George Deatherage from navy work because the Secretary of the Navy, Colonel Frank Knox, found Deatherage to be an undesirable person within the meaning of the naval contract. It noted that there has been considerable critical discussion of Deatherage's employment as the chief engineer to private contractors on a 30,000,000-dollar project at the Norfolk Naval Base because Deatherage was formerly the leader of the organisation known as the Knights of the White Camelia. an allegedly Fascist and anti-Semitic organisation.
